Program:
Accessible Technology Development Program
Program Purpose:
The Accessible Technology Program co-funds projects led by research institutes, private sector companies and not-for-profit organizations to develop innovative assistive and adaptive digital devices and technologies for persons with disabilities to facilitate their participation and inclusion in the digital economy.
